Sacaton, Ariz. (AP) -- One suspect was killed and another wounded after a gunbattle with police on the Gila River Indian Reservation early Monday.
Gila River police Sgt. Stephanie Nelson said officers began pursuing a car following a carjacking around 1:30 a.m. During the pursuit, Nelson said the suspects fired at officers, hitting the windshield on a patrol car.
The officers returned fire and the car crashed.
Even after the crash, the suspects continued to fire at the officers, Nelson said.
One suspect was killed; the other was hospitalized with minor injuries.
One officer was slightly injured by flying glass, she said.
In a separate police shooting in Mesa, also on Monday morning, a man was hospitalized after being shot by police. He was shot after a verbal and physical confrontation with officers, police said. His injuries were not believed to be life-threatening.
